Comunicazione bluetooth lenta

Salve ragazzi,
mi sto cimentando da qualche giorno nell'interfacciamento tra un dispositivo android ed arduino tramite una app creata da me.
Nel caso specifico mi piacerebbe visualizzare un conto alla rovescia in secondi.
Tale conteggio pero', vorrei che venga visualizzato al cellure in perfetta sincronia (o quasi ) ad un display lcd collegato ad arduino.
Purtroppo al momento noto un ritardo di circa un secondo tra la scrittura su display e la visualizzazione su cellulare.
Potete darmi qualche dritta??

Ecco lo sketch che uso al momento:

#include <openGLCD.h>
int s=200;
unsigned long tempo;
void setup() 
{
   Serial.begin(115200);
       GLCD.Init();
       GLCD.SelectFont(System5x7);       
}
void loop() {
        
        if (millis() - tempo >= 1000)
          {
            tempo += 1000;                    
            s--;       //decremento i secondi
            GLCD.CursorTo(0, 1); GLCD.print(s);            
            Serial.print (s);         
          }
}

Grazie a tutti

GLCD.print(s+1);

e problema risolto ;D ;D ;D

GLCD.print(s+1);

e problema risolto ;D ;D ;D

Ci avevo pensato anche io veramente :)))))

nessuno può aiutarmi? :frowning: